Pants immersed in hyperbolic 3-manifolds

Ian Agol

Vol. 241 (2009), No. 2, 201–214
Abstract

We show that a properly immersed thrice-punctured sphere in a cusped orientable hyperbolic 3-manifold is either embedded or has a single clasp in a manifold that is the Whitehead link complement or obtained by hyperbolic Dehn filling on a cusp of the Whitehead link complement.
